Transaction 78909c8dd6b64140ee6057753a2357080648b289bdc1093c32ca79a796fd03a4
1 Input
1 Output
-
78909c8dd6b64140ee6057753a2357080648b289bdc1093c32ca79a796fd03a4:0
- value
- 93822
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d758509078821329232f12da9ec4e7b014e6951f OP_EQUAL
- address
- 3MKezzz3srcGvZy5f8RcLQBxLnzYPNrwwa